CLAM::Flags< N > Member List
This is the complete list of members for
CLAM::Flags< N >, including all inherited members.
CheckInvariant() | CLAM::FlagsBase | [inline] |
DeepCopy() const | CLAM::Flags< N > | [inline, virtual] |
Flags(tFlagValue *names) | CLAM::Flags< N > | [inline, protected] |
Flags(tFlagValue *names, const Flags< N > &t) | CLAM::Flags< N > | [inline, protected] |
Flags(tFlagValue *names, const T &t) | CLAM::Flags< N > | [inline, protected] |
Flags(tFlagValue *names, const T1 &t1, const T2 &t2) | CLAM::Flags< N > | [inline, protected] |
GetClassName() const | CLAM::Flags< N > | [inline, virtual] |
GetFlagPosition(const std::string &whichOne) const | CLAM::FlagsBase | |
GetFlagString(unsigned int whichOne) const | CLAM::FlagsBase | |
GetNFlags() const | CLAM::Flags< N > | [inline, virtual] |
IsSetFlag(unsigned int whichOne) const | CLAM::Flags< N > | [inline, protected, virtual] |
LoadFrom(Storage &storage) | CLAM::FlagsBase | [virtual] |
mFlagValues | CLAM::FlagsBase | [protected] |
SetFlag(unsigned int whichOne, bool value=true) | CLAM::Flags< N > | [inline, protected, virtual] |
ShallowCopy() const | CLAM::Flags< N > | [inline, virtual] |
Species() const =0 | CLAM::Flags< N > | [pure virtual] |
StoreOn(Storage &storage) const | CLAM::FlagsBase | [virtual] |
tValue typedef | CLAM::FlagsBase | |
~Component() | CLAM::Component | [virtual] |
~Flags() | CLAM::Flags< N > | [inline, virtual] |